Quick Verdict

CodeGeeX excels at AI-driven code completion across over 20 programming languages, making it a versatile assistant for developers working in multilingual environments. The tool’s predictive suggestions can significantly reduce manual typing and common syntax errors. However, the lack of transparent pricing information makes it difficult to evaluate its cost-effectiveness compared to alternatives. Developers who need broad language support and want to accelerate their coding workflow should consider testing CodeGeeX, especially if they work across multiple tech stacks.

CodeGeeX Features

  • AI-Driven Code Completion: Predicts and suggests code completions, reducing manual effort and errors.
  • Multilingual Support: Works with over 20 programming languages, making it versatile for various platforms.
  • Intelligent Debugging: Offers smart debugging suggestions to quickly identify and resolve errors.
  • smooth Integration: Easily integrates with popular IDEs and development tools for a smooth workflow.

Getting Started

Begin by testing CodeGeeX with your most frequently used programming languages to gauge its suggestion accuracy. Create a simple test file in 2-3 different languages you regularly work with, and observe how well the AI predicts your coding patterns. This practical approach helps you quickly determine if the tool fits your specific workflow before committing time to deeper integration.

Related Workflows and Tool Pairings

CodeGeeX fits naturally into the initial coding phase of development workflows, where it accelerates writing and reduces repetitive typing. When integrated with version control systems, it helps maintain consistent code patterns across team contributions. This tool pairs well with code review platforms that catch logic errors CodeGeeX might miss, and testing frameworks that validate the functionality of AI-suggested code. For complete development pipelines, consider combining CodeGeeX with project management tools that track coding velocity improvements, and documentation generators that can explain complex AI-generated code segments to team members.
